The Off-Road Motorsports Hall Of Fame Announces The 2012 Class Of Inductees

July 24, 2012 (Reno, NV) – Today, the Off-Road Motorsports Hall of Fame (ORMHOF) announced the 2012 Class of Inductees. The late Roy Denner, Casey Folks and Larry Roeseler will have their names added to the venerable list of those who have committed their lives to the off-road community. SCORE Int’l Set To Introduce SCORE Super 8 Truck Class At This Year’s 45th Tecate SCORE Baja 1000

LOS ANGELES—As it has for nearly 40 years as the preeminent desert racing organization in the world, SCORE International is adding to its legacy of innovation and pioneering technology development with the announcement this week by SCORE CEO/President Sal Fish of the new manufacturer-friendly SCORE Super 8 Truck class. Major Performance Displayed At The Baja 500

(Ensenada, Baja California) – Matt Cullen’s Major performance powered Alumi Craft displayed impressive speed on his way to winning class ten at the SCORE, Baja 500 in Ensenada, Mexico. Matt Cullen And Chuck Sacks Take An Impressive Victory In Alumi Craft Car At The Baja 500.

(Ensenada, Baja California) – Matt Cullen and Chuck Sacks drove their Alumi Craft / F&L Racing Fuel class 10 car to an impressive victory at the SCORE, Baja 500 in Ensenada, Mexico.
